    As I've been tracking my drop beginning the start of February, these are the steps it went through:

    1) drop in SERPs for main keyword, went from 1st page to about 5th page in beginning of Feb
    2) mid-to-late Feb it disappeared from SERPs for main keyword and was on third-fifth page for search of exact domain
    3) this week it disappeared from google for search of exact domain

    A site command shows my disclaimer and search page but not my home page. I remember this happening when I first built the site because I thought it was weird my disclaimer page was showing up in a search but my home page was not. Looking in Google Sitemaps it says my homepage is still indexed.

    The site appears not banned because you'd think it would get banned all at once and my adsense would get shut down but some pages are still indexed and it has a strong PR4 still. I wonder if they are "relearning" my site? Weird stuff.

    More info to chew on: I added an affiliate link in December, text-link-ads in January, lots of unique content from a new columnist starting in November, and bought lots of high quality, high PR, relevant links over the last 3 months. I still rank first page in Yahoo and MSN for my keyword.
